竹木是中国传统社会中不可或缺的重要生产资料和生活资料。清代长江流域的竹木长途贩运贸易极为兴盛,在全国竹木流通网络中地位殊重;而“九省通衢”的汉口镇则是长江流域竹木产销两地之间规模巨大的中转集散市场。本文通过汉口竹木的来源和销售去向,考察其竹木市场的兴衰变化。在此基础上,尝试利用长江中游之工关—荆关较长时段的税收数据及其按价银3%征收的税率,反推其竹木的流通量与价值量,进而大致估测其贸易规模;认为汉口是清代长江流域最大的竹木中转集散市场。
